Tokeneke Research LLC is a research firm focused on the semiconductor industry, positioned as a provider of industry analysis and insights for investment professionals. The core services disclosed on its website are not marketing or SEO software, but investment-oriented research and consulting: analysis of semiconductor industry trends, sales statistics, stock market performance, fundamental outlooks, and company valuations.
Its offerings fall into four categories: monthly newsletters, industry reports, company reports, and consulting services. The monthly newsletter typically includes two pages of text plus several recurring charts and tables, making it suitable for relatively broad distribution. Industry reports are published semiannually and cover multi-year forecasts, sub-sector or end-market reviews, sector valuation relationships, and industry overviews. Company reports include fundamental equity research, earnings forecasts, and customized valuation analysis. Consulting services support short- or long-term special projects, and expert access can also be arranged at different frequencies.
The site states that its reports cover industry business developments, sales statistics, stock market performance, and forecast updates, but it does not specify the underlying data sources, sample sizes, number of companies covered, or methodology. Delivery appears relatively traditional: publications are typically distributed by email in PDF format unless otherwise requested by the client. There is no visible information about an online database, dashboard, API, third-party integrations, or self-service subscription platform.
The website does not publish fixed plans or a price list, noting only that fees vary depending on the nature, duration, and terms of the service. Support is mainly handled through direct contact with founder Dan K. Scovel, with a phone number and email address provided on the site. The firm explicitly supports client confidentiality and exclusivity for custom research, which may be valuable for institutional investors, funds, or corporate strategy teams. However, it also means prospective buyers need to discuss scope, deliverables, and fees individually before purchasing.
Its strengths lie in the founder’s background in electrical engineering, nearly 12 years of semiconductor industry experience, and nearly 8 years as a Wall Street analyst, along with recognition from The Wall Street Journal for semiconductor analysis. The service model is flexible and well suited to professional clients who need expert judgment and customized research. The main drawback is limited public transparency: there are no sample reports, update logs, pricing details, data-source disclosures, or current coverage lists. It is not a good fit for teams looking for standardized SaaS tools, SEO data platforms, or real-time dashboards.
